Patch My PC

Patch My PC

Patch My PC automates third party app management in Microsoft ConfigMgr and Intune, saving time, money, and enhancing security for enterprises and home users.

Internet Software & Services
51-250
Founded 2011

Description

  • Drive architectural direction for backend services and distributed systems.
  • Lead cross-functional initiatives that reduce technical debt and improve long-term maintainability.
  • Design and implement scalable microservices and RESTful APIs.
  • Own complex backend features from design through production support.
  • Translate product requirements into system designs and implementation plans.
  • Improve performance, reliability, and observability across services.
  • Apply secure development practices to protect customer and internal data.
  • Mentor engineers through code reviews, design discussions, and technical guidance.
  • Evaluate emerging technologies through proof-of-concept experimentation.

Requirements

  • 8+ years of professional experience building software with C# and the .NET ecosystem.
  • Deep experience building and operating ASP.NET Core microservices in production.
  • Demonstrated ability to work independently on complex technical challenges and drive resolution across teams.
  • Experience leveraging AI coding assistants while maintaining strong code ownership, critical review, and debugging discipline.
  • Strong experience designing scalable and secure RESTful APIs.
  • Hands-on experience with MongoDB or similar NoSQL databases, including data modeling and performance optimization.
  • Experience designing distributed systems with reliability, scalability, and fault tolerance in mind.
  • Experience with Docker and Kubernetes, including containerization strategy and CI/CD integration.
  • Strong knowledge of secure development practices, including authentication, encryption, and data protection.
  • Deep understanding of object-oriented principles and design patterns.
  • Proficiency with Git and collaborative development workflows.
  • Experience with device management platforms such as Microsoft Configuration Manager or Intune (nice to have).
  • Familiarity with additional languages such as React, Golang, JavaScript, C++, or PowerShell (nice to have).
  • Experience building or maintaining enterprise desktop applications using WPF or similar frameworks (nice to have).
  • Experience with AWS, Azure, or Google Cloud (nice to have).
  • Familiarity with event-driven architectures (nice to have).
  • Experience building cross-platform applications or services (nice to have).

Benefits

  • Competitive base salary of $150,000 to $170,000 based on experience and location.
  • 401(k) match of 200% of contributions up to the first 5% of salary, for a total potential match of 10%.
  • Medical, dental, and vision coverage with Patch My PC covering 99% of premiums for team members and dependents.
  • FSA/HSA benefits.
  • Fertility benefits.
  • Parental leave and paid time off.
  • Volunteer leave and charitable donation matching.
  • Tuition reimbursement.
  • Gym membership reimbursement, internet stipend, and pet insurance.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Digital Mission Engineering Intern

NextGen Federal Systems 51-250 Internet Software & Services

NextGen Federal Systems is hiring a remote Digital Mission Engineering Intern to support digital mission engineering projects through hands-on mentorship and team collaboration.

Cybersecurity
6 minutes ago

Senior Software Engineer (FS Node/Go/Python)

Metova 51-250 Internet Software & Services

Full Stack Developer at a company building scalable, microservices-based products with modern event-driven architectures and chatbot integrations.

AWS Azure CI/CD Docker Git Go GraphQL JWT Kafka Kubernetes LLM Microservices MongoDB Node.js PostgreSQL Python RabbitMQ React Redis REST API SQL Server
6 minutes ago

Future Engineer

Brilliant.org 51-250 Diversified Consumer Services

Brilliant is seeking a future-consideration software engineer to join small, high-performing teams building interactive learning products for millions of learners.

6 minutes ago

Software Engineer, Frontend

Bryan Johnson - State Farm Insurance Agent Diversified Financial Services

Blueprint is hiring a Frontend Engineer to help build its early digital product experience, turning complex biological and AI-driven insights into clear, engaging web interfaces.

JavaScript LLM Next.js React TypeScript
6 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ers